Summary
Join Massive Rocket, a rapidly growing Braze & Snowflake agency, as a Snowflake Consultant. You will design and implement high-performance data solutions on Snowflake's cloud platform, collaborating with cross-functional teams. Responsibilities include managing datasets, executing data transformations, designing data models, and ensuring data quality. You will also analyze data, translate findings into actionable insights, and utilize data for customer engagement through Braze. Collaboration with data engineers, analysts, and stakeholders is crucial. This role requires a Bachelor's degree, 4+ years of Snowflake development experience, and expertise in SQL, data modeling, and ETL processes. The position is 100% remote.
Requirements
- Bachelor's degree in Computer Science, Information Technology, or equivalent work experience
- 4+ years of working as Snowflake Developer or in a similar role
- 4+ years of experience in SQL and data modeling and ETL processes
- 2+ years of experience of working with Python
- Experience with Snowflake features such as Snowpipe, Snowflake Data Sharing, and Snowflake Secure Data Sharing
- Experience with cloud platforms (e.g., AWS, Azure, Google Cloud) and data integration tools
- Excellent problem-solving skills and attention to detail
- Strong communication skills with the ability to convey complex data concepts to non-technical stakeholders
- Ability to work independently and collaboratively in a fast-paced environment
- Experience working in an agency setting or experience working with external clients
Responsibilities
- Setting up and maintaining ETL pipelines in the Snowflake environment across a variety of architectures (real-time and batch, internal/external storage systems, dynamic tables, tasks)
- Implement Snowflake solutions that integrate seamlessly with existing data architecture
- Optimize the performance of Snowflake databases, including designing and implementing data structures and using indexes appropriately
- Deploying and configuring tools to monitor and report on the performance of the Snowflake system
- Ensure data quality and integrity across all Snowflake data solutions (QA process, Unit Testsβ¦)
- Use large datasets and a variety of analytical techniques to tell compelling stories with the data in an easy-to-understand manner
- Translate complex data analyses into actionable insights and recommendations for business stakeholders
- Help build Snowflake into the core source of data to power Braze and Customer Engagement initiatives
- Be able to work through a Customer Engagement data plan and translate it into an actionable set of data models in Snowflake
- Understand and work with core Customer Engagement and Braze concepts such as custom events, user attributes and syncing data from Snowflake into Braze
- Collaborate with data engineers, analysts, and other stakeholders to ensure alignment on data strategy and implementation
- Provide technical support and guidance to team members on Snowflake best practices and optimization techniques
- Support customers in leveraging unused features of the Snowflake platform that can either provide efficiencies or cost-savings across the stack
- Align with the internal CDP and CRM team to work on the data plan and therefore power the Braze platform in the most efficient way possible
Preferred Qualifications
- Snowflake certification
- Experience with other data warehousing solutions (e.g., Redshift, BigQuery)
- Knowledge of data visualization tools (e.g., Tableau, Power BI)
- Understanding of data governance and security best practices
- Experience working in Scrum
Benefits
- 100% remote forever
- Career progression paths and opportunities for promotion/advancement
- Organised team events and outings
Disclaimer: Please check that the job is real before you apply. Applying might take you to another website that we don't own. Please be aware that any actions taken during the application process are solely your responsibility, and we bear no responsibility for any outcomes.